/*
 * BLOOM_BITS_PER_KEY for the Fenwick cache layer in front of Duskstore.
 * Note for the release manager: bumping this above 12 roughly doubles
 * memory on the edge nodes but only shaves false positives from 0.9%
 * to 0.4% — not worth it at current read volumes. If the miss-heavy
 * workload from the Tiverly migration lands, revisit. Any change here
 * requires a full filter rebuild, so coordinate with the rollout window.
 * The build this tuning was validated against is recorded below.
 */

pipeline stamp: htk6_35e0c9

/*
 * Client setup for the Fenwick tax-rate lookup cache.
 * Security review notes: this client only performs reads against the
 * internal Fenwick rates API; write paths are handled by a separate
 * service with its own credential. Responses are cached in-process for
 * 15 minutes, so stale-rate exposure is bounded. TLS is enforced by the
 * client constructor and cannot be disabled via config. The read-only
 * credential is scoped to the rates namespace only. For authentication,
 * the client uses the key below.
 */

gateway credential: kto23_LX9A4ys6i4nzHtpOLNLodKK

**Internal Memo – Launch Plan: Fernlight 2.0**

To: Finance team

Launch set for 12 May. Marketing spend capped at the Q2 envelope; no supplementary requests. Pricing confirmed at tier parity with Fernlight Classic. Inventory pre-build starts week 14 at the Dunmarsh facility. Finance to lock unit cost models by end of month. Queries to Rhea. Read the following before the pricing call.

internal memo for kaduf-baduf: Only 35 of the 378 pilot accounts renewed Holir, so a churn review is set for June 11. Eliielax Group is in early talks to buy Silaelix Group for about $142.1 million.